Setting Eyes on the Retinal Pigment Epithelium
24 Oct 2018
Abstract excerpt
The neural component of the zebrafish eye derives from a small group of cells known as the eye/retinal field. These cells, positioned in the anterior neural plate, rearrange extensively and generate the optic vesicles. Each vesicle subsequently folds over itself to form the double-layered optic cup, from which the mature eye derives. During this transition, cells of the optic vesicle are progressively specified...
